<p>Singapore is becoming an increasingly attractive destination for UK veterinarians seeking rewarding careers abroad. Known for its advanced veterinary facilities, high professional standards, and well-regulated industry, the city-state offers exceptional opportunities for RCVS-accredited vets to expand their horizons.</p>



<p>With its modern infrastructure, cultural diversity, and strong public safety, Singapore combines a high quality of life with a thriving professional environment. This guide explains the veterinary landscape, outlines the licensing process, and provides practical tips to help you transition smoothly into the Singapore veterinary sector.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Overview of the Singapore Veterinary Healthcare Sector</strong></h2>



<p>Singapore’s veterinary profession is predominantly urban-based, private, and tightly regulated.<a href="https://www.nparks.gov.sg/avs"><mark style="background-color:rgba(0, 0, 0, 0);color:#7a3ab6" class="has-inline-color"> The Animal &amp; Veterinary Service (AVS)</mark></a> under<a href="https://www.nparks.gov.sg/"> <mark style="background-color:rgba(0, 0, 0, 0);color:#7d35bf" class="has-inline-color">NParks</mark></a> oversees licensure, practice standards, animal welfare, and disease control.</p>



<p>Most veterinarians work in companion animal clinics, although opportunities also exist in exotic, avian, and wildlife medicine. This structured ecosystem ensures consistent professionalism, accountability, and high service standards for both practitioners and clients.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Unique Veterinary Services in Singapore</strong></h3>



<ol class="wp-block-list">
<li><strong>Speciality Referral Centres:</strong> Advanced care in oncology, cardiology, dermatology, and orthopaedics by board-certified specialists.</li>



<li><strong>24-Hour Emergency Hospitals:</strong> Round-the-clock urgent and post-surgery care.</li>



<li><strong>Mobile Veterinary Services:</strong> Home visits for consultations and basic treatments, ideal for anxious or elderly pets.</li>



<li><strong>Integrative Therapies:</strong> Acupuncture, physiotherapy, and hydrotherapy for recovery and pain management.</li>



<li><strong>Exotic Pet Care:</strong> Treatment for birds, reptiles, amphibians, and small mammals, reflecting Singapore’s diverse pet population.</li>
</ol>

<h2 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Steps for UK-Qualified Vets to Work in Singapore</strong></h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Step 1: Confirm Your Degree is Recognised</strong></h3>



<p>RCVS-accredited UK veterinary degrees are recognised by<a href="https://www.nparks.gov.sg/avs"> <mark style="background-color:rgba(0, 0, 0, 0);color:#6f3e9d" class="has-inline-color">AVS</mark>,</a> meaning you can apply for a licence without sitting additional veterinary exams. If your degree is not recognised, you would need to pass an approved licensing examination such as the RCVS Statutory examination.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Step 2: Secure Employment and a Work Pass</strong></h3>



<p>You must hold a valid Employment Pass, sponsored by a prospective employer, a veterinary clinic, or a hospital, to legally work in Singapore. This enables you to apply for your veterinary licence and is handled by your employer. <h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Step 3: Apply for the Licence to Treat Animals and Birds</strong></h3>



<p>Applications are submitted via the GoBusiness Licensing Portal using SingPass. Required documents include:</p>



<ol class="wp-block-list">
<li>Certified true copy of the veterinary degree and other qualifications</li>



<li>Letter of Good Standing from RCVS (fresh graduates may be exempt)</li>



<li>Curriculum vitae</li>



<li>Passport copy and passport-sized photograph</li>



<li>EP approval or sponsorship letter</li>



<li>Employer’s endorsement</li>



<li>Supervisor’s endorsement (optional)<br>Processing time: Approximately 25 working days for complete applications.</li>
</ol>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Step 4: Obtain and Maintain Your Licence</strong></h3>



<p>Once approved, you will receive your licence, valid for up to two years. The issuance fee is SGD 80; there is no application fee. Some practices may require new licensees to work under supervision initially. Renewal requires CPE records and, in some cases, performance assessments.</p>

<h2 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Key Tips for a Smooth Transition to Veterinary Practice in Singapore</strong></h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Start Documentation Early</strong></h3>



<p>Gather certified documents and good-standing letters well in advance, as these can take weeks to obtain.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Choose Employers with Overseas Hiring Experience</strong></h3>



<p>Employers familiar with EP and AVS licensing can greatly streamline your relocation process.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Prepare for a Small-Animal Focus</strong></h3>



<p>Given Singapore’s urban environment, most veterinary cases involve companion animals.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Meet High Client Expectations</strong></h3>



<p>Singaporean pet owners value clear communication, thorough diagnostics, and transparent treatment plans.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Understand Local Regulations</strong></h3>



<p>Be aware of rules on controlled drugs, pet import/export, microchipping, and zoonotic disease reporting.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Budget for a High Cost of Living</strong></h3>



<p>Singapore ranks among the world’s most expensive cities. Factor in housing, healthcare, and transport when negotiating your salary.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Engage with Professional Networks</strong></h3>



<p>Key organisations include:</p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>Singapore Veterinary Association (SVA): CPD events, advocacy, and networking</li>



<li>Singapore Veterinary Nurses &amp; Technicians (SVNT): Collaboration and support for veterinary teams</li>
</ul>
